Abstract: In this study, we analyzed the expressional pattern of Shp2 gene on the transcriptional level in mice testicles in different developmental stages. General RT-PCR and Real-time PCR were uesd to investigate the Shp2 expression in 16 groups of postnatal mice according to the differently developmental stages. The result showed that the temporal expression of Shp2 gene in mice testicles presented successively regardless of the daily growth according to the general RT-PCR assay. The result of Real-time PCR showed that, during the period from twentieth day to thirty-first day, the expression quantity of Shp2 gene fluctuated from the extremly significantly increase (P<0.01) to extremly significantly decrease (P<0.01) to extremly significantly increase again (P<0.01), and finally, the amount was back to normal gradually after the thirty-first day (P>0.05).The results indicated that Shp2 involved in the development of mouse testis, but the functions in details needed to be explored and investigated in depth.
